I have a 96 Bronco with a 351 in it. The checkengine light is on and it has a trouble code of PO443 also the Overdrive light flashes and the engine seems to surge at 1200-1500 RPMS. The sirge quits if I plug the egr. Anybody have any Ideas of what to check? I have checked the VMV and it has the correct ohms resistance.
I ran jumper wires to the VMV and it opened the solenoid letting vacuum thru. I also warmed the truck up and put a test light to the ground side to check when ground occured when I revved the motor to about1500 RPMS the light came on. The red wire going to the valve does have power going to it.

I got a used VMV at a yard and it does the same thing. I thought even if the used one was bad it would do something different. Is there a way for the EGR solenoid to steal the voltage. Since when I pull the vacuum line off it the motor stops surging.
The EVR (EGR Solenoid Regulator) is also in the same circuit as the other items mentioned before. The EVR is modulated on and off by the PCM. I would start metering that supply voltage to see if it is being pulled down or perhaps there is significant ripple on it.
I have a seen a few cases of intermittent O/D light flashing with no codes to be caused by a bad alternator. Usually caused by too much ripple on the output. Maybe there is a connection to that and your P0443 problem?
The reason I think it has something to do with the EGR is it surges worse when the engine is cold and what I hear the EGR shouldn't function until the motor is warm Which sensor tells the PCM to turn on the EGR. I have replaced the heat sensor on top of the thermostat
The reason I think it has something to do with the EGR is it surges worse when the engine is cold and what I hear the EGR shouldn't function until the motor is warm Which sensor tells the PCM to turn on the EGR. I have replaced the heat sensor on top of the thermostat
It's a combination of ECT and TPS, perhaps the Engine RPM comes into play as well. Once the engine is warmed up and light load cruising is the only time the EGR should be active.
